Web Service SOAP

26145282 - ¿Qué es el Web Service SOAP?
Fecha de publicación: 18/03/2025

Un Web Service (WS) es un conjunto de estándares y protocolos, basados en texto, que sirven para intercambiar datos entre aplicaciones a través de un contenido accesible y fácil funcionamiento.

Las distintas aplicaciones de software desarrolladas en lenguajes de programación diferentes (ejecutadas sobre cualquier plataforma) pueden utilizar servicios web para intercambiar datos en redes de ordenadores como internet.

  • Fuente: ARCA
26145283 - ¿Qué ventajas tienen los Web Service SOAP (WS)?
Fecha de publicación: 18/03/2025

Los WS aportan una mayor interoperabilidad entre aplicaciones de software independientemente de sus propiedades o de las plataformas sobre las que se encuentran instalados. Además, los Servicios Web permiten que software de diferentes compañías (ubicadas en distintos lugares geográficos) puedan ser combinados fácilmente para proveer servicios integrados.


  • Fuente: ARCA
26145284 - ¿A cuántos entornos pueden accederse?
Fecha de publicación: 18/03/2025

ARCA dispone de 2 entornos bien definidos:

El entorno de testing: donde los programadores de aplicaciones pueden solicitar acceso a los diversos WS que están disponibles a los efectos de probar sus aplicaciones clientes.

El entorno de producción: donde se trabaja diariamente afectando al comercio exterior.


  • Fuente: ARCA
26145285 - ¿Cómo se generan los Certificados Digitales?
Fecha de publicación: 18/03/2025

Para el entorno de testing se dispone de la aplicación web WSASS (Autoservicio de Acceso a APIs de Homologación), que está disponible accediendo con clave fiscal al portal de ARCA.

Para el entorno de producción se dispone de la aplicación web Administrador de Certificados Digitales, que está disponible accediendo con clave fiscal al portal de ARCA.


MANUAL “GENERACIÓN DE CERTIFICADOS PARA PRODUCCIÓN”

  • Fuente: ARCA
26145287 - ¿Cuándo vencen y cómo se renueva un certificado expirado?
Fecha de publicación: 18/03/2025

Los certificados digitales de los token vencen a los dos años de ser activados. Cuando esto ocurre, los dispositivos ya no pueden ser utilizados. Es importante destacar que no es posible renovarlo antes de que falten como mínimo 30 días para su vencimiento.

Para conocer cuándo se produce el vencimiento del certificado, se deberá ingresar a la página de ARCA con la clave fiscal a "Autoridad Certificante", luego a "Mis Certificados" y posteriormente a "Ver detalles", para visualizar la fecha exacta de vencimiento del certificado.

  • Fuente: ARCA
26145287 - ¿Cuándo vencen y cómo se renueva un certificado expirado?
Fecha de publicación: 18/03/2025

Los certificados digitales de los token vencen a los dos años de ser activados. Cuando esto ocurre, los dispositivos ya no pueden ser utilizados. Es importante destacar que no es posible renovarlo antes de que falten como mínimo 30 días para su vencimiento.

Para conocer cuándo se produce el vencimiento del certificado, se deberá ingresar a la página de ARCA con la clave fiscal a "Autoridad Certificante", luego a "Mis Certificados" y posteriormente a "Ver detalles", para visualizar la fecha exacta de vencimiento del certificado.

  • Fuente: ARCA
26145286 - ¿Cómo se delega un Web Service provisto por ARCA?
Fecha de publicación: 18/03/2025

Para delegar cualquier WS provisto por ARCA, se debe acceder al servicio con clave fiscal "Administrador de Relaciones con Clave Fiscal" y allí seleccionar la "Nueva Relación" para el Web Service que desea crear.

MANUAL “DELEGACIÓN DE WEBSERVICES CON EL ADMINISTRADOR DE RELACIONES”

  • Fuente: AFIP
26145288 - ¿Qué es un XML? ¿Cuál es la diferencia entre un XML de entrada y un XML de salida?
Fecha de publicación: 18/03/2025

Los mensajes XML contienen la comunicación transmitida entre el sistema y ARCA en el formato de intercambio de los servicios web.

Atributo XmlRequest (requerimiento.xml): incluye credenciales de acceso y la solicitud remota (método a utilizar, parámetros, etc.)

Atributo XmlResponse (respuesta.xml): incluye los datos devueltos por el proceso remoto, incluyendo mensajes de error (si corresponde)

Almacenar estos archivos es de vital importancia para el registro de las operaciones realizadas por webservice y su eventual verificación, depuración o solución de inconvenientes. La información contenida en estos archivos es sólo relevante a los desarrolladores, no es necesario que sean enviados al usuario final.


  • Fuente: ARCA
26145288 - ¿Qué es un XML? ¿Cuál es la diferencia entre un XML de entrada y un XML de salida?
Fecha de publicación: 18/03/2025

Los mensajes XML contienen la comunicación transmitida entre el sistema y ARCA en el formato de intercambio de los servicios web.

Atributo XmlRequest (requerimiento.xml): incluye credenciales de acceso y la solicitud remota (método a utilizar, parámetros, etc.)

Atributo XmlResponse (respuesta.xml): incluye los datos devueltos por el proceso remoto, incluyendo mensajes de error (si corresponde)

Almacenar estos archivos es de vital importancia para el registro de las operaciones realizadas por webservice y su eventual verificación, depuración o solución de inconvenientes. La información contenida en estos archivos es sólo relevante a los desarrolladores, no es necesario que sean enviados al usuario final.


  • Fuente: ARCA